EC Number |
General Stability |
Reference |
---|
2.7.1.11 | (NH4)2SO4 prevents enzyme from dissociation at pH 6.4 |
640423 |
2.7.1.11 | 10% glycerol, dithiothreitol and PMSF stabilize during purification |
640482 |
2.7.1.11 | 50 mM phosphate stabilizes at pH 6.6 |
640432 |
2.7.1.11 | AMP, ADP, fructose 6-phosphate or antipain stabilizes during purification |
640452 |
2.7.1.11 | at least 15 mM phosphate required to stabilize PFK during purification, presence of 10% glycerol helps to stabilize |
640448 |
2.7.1.11 | ATP stabilizes |
640445 |
2.7.1.11 | cold labile, fructose 1,6-bisphosphate stabilizes |
640434 |
2.7.1.11 | concentration by ultrafiltration on Amicon PM-10 membrane results in appreciable loss of activity, concentration in collodium bags allows higher protein concentration to be obtained without loss of activity |
640452 |
2.7.1.11 | cytosolic enzyme extremely unstable upon purification, substrates, metabolites, ethylene glycol or SH-compounds do not stabilize |
640444 |
2.7.1.11 | cytosolic enzymes are less stable than plastidic |
640440 |
